Vehicle Pursuit

Contact: Watch CommanderPhone: (805) 781-4553Date and time of incident: 10-17-12 at 10:16 PMPlace of Occurrence: South Frontage Road at Tefft Street in NipomoVictim Information: N/ASuspect Information: Ruben Jay Rivera, 28 years old, NipomoOn 10-17-12 at 10:16 PM, Sheriff's Deputies initiated a traffic stop at the service station island area at the Nipomo Chervron Station located at the above location. The stop was initiated for traffic violations and suspicion that the driver had outstanding arrest warrants. After initially stopping, the driver accelerated out of the service station, failing to yield, and initiated a pursuit. The driver, subsequently identified as Ruben Jay Rivera, proceeded approximately 160 yards on South Frontage Road where upon attempting to navigate his vehicle on an off-road embankment, lost control and became stuck in the sand. The driver immediately fled from the scene on foot and into a neighboring yard. With the assistance of the California Highway Patrol, a Sheriff's K-9, and patrol deputies, a subsequent search of the cordoned off yard resulted in Rivera's apprehension without incident. Rivera was arrested and booked into County Jail for felony pursuit, resisting arrest, and an outstanding local misdemeanor warrant.

During the suspect's flight, his entry into a neighboring yard resulted in the unintentional release of the property owner's four (4) Chihuahua dogs. Any member of the public with information related to the location of the missing dog(s) in the Nipomo area is encouraged to notify Sheriff's Dispatch at (805) 781-4550.
